Vijay Breaks Silence On Divorce With Sangeetha: 'People Around Me Waited...'
In a rare and emotionally charged public address, Tamilaga Vettri Kazhagam (TVK) chief Vijay has finally addressed the swirling controversy surrounding his personal life, linking the recent divorce filing by his estranged wife, Sangeetha, to a coordinated attempt by political rivals to derail his burgeoning career in public service.
"You Cannot Separate Me From the People"
Addressing a massive gathering on Wednesday, the actor-turned-politician broke his long-standing silence regarding his matrimonial dispute. Vijay characterized the timing of the legal proceedings-arriving just weeks before the state elections-as a calculated move by "those around him" to tarnish his reputation.

"The people around me waited for many years and tried to defame me 30 days before the elections," Vijay stated. "No matter how many trials and pains you put me through, you can't separate me from the people."
The remarks come in the wake of a divorce petition filed by Sangeetha in the Chengalpattu District Family Court on February 24, 2026. Seeking dissolution under the Special Marriage Act, the petition alleges "emotional and mental cruelty" and "constructive desertion." Sangeetha claims the marriage has "irretrievably broken down" after two years of living separately.
In her petition, Sangeetha alleges that she discovered in April 2021 that Vijay was involved in an adulterous relationship with an actress. She claims that even after he initially promised to end the relationship, it allegedly continued between September 2021 and February 2022, leading to emotional and mental cruelty, public humiliation (through social‑media posts), and what she describes as "constructive desertion."
She also states that she has been living separately from Vijay for about two years and that the marriage has "irretrievably broken down," existing only on paper.
Using his divorce issue, Vijay has been targeted by his political rivals.
Vijay Attacks DMK
While addressing his personal tribulations, Vijay pivoted to a blistering critique of the DMK-led government. Labeling the ruling front a "cash-box alliance," he alleged the coalition was built on "looted funds" rather than shared ideology.
Vijay took particular aim at Chief Minister M.K. Stalin, describing the current administration as a "caretaker government" lacking real authority. He claimed that if the DMK had "full power," they would have blocked his events.

In a surprising ideological maneuver, Vijay also claimed that the "real Congress" is now aligned with the TVK, accusing the DMK of "buying over" the official state unit with crores of rupees.
"For others, this may just be an election," Vijay concluded, "but for those in the TVK, it is an emotion." As the legal battle in Chengalpattu unfolds, the political battle for Tamil Nadu appears to be entering its most personal and volatile phase yet.
